In 1975, the #Cambodian capital of Phnom Penh fell to a rebel movement known as the Khmer Rouge. These #Marxist revolutionaries seized control of the country and unleashed a reign of terror rarely seen in modern history. Over the next four years, the regime, led by #dictator Pol Pot, was responsible for the deaths of nearly a quarter of Cambodia’s #population. Entire communities were destroyed, and the nation’s religious and cultural #heritage was systematically dismantled.

The horrors of the Cambodian killing fields are difficult to confront, but they cannot be ignored. In a 1948 speech to the British House of Commons, Prime Minister Winston #Churchill warned, “Those who fail to learn from history are condemned to repeat it.” So what can we learn from the story of the Cambodian killing fields, and how can we ensure such a tragedy is never repeated?
